First of all, the material is something that adds value to the solar system of energy. It is made up of photovoltaic cells. These cells are highly significant as they convert sunlight into maximum energy.
Now, a question arises whether they convert all of the energy or not. Here, one thing is certain: there has not been any solar panel yet that could convert all of the sunlight into useful energy. There is a solution for that too and it is present in the form of efficiency. This parameter is helpful as it provides a better idea regarding the percentage of energy that will be converted into functional energy.
Talking about the trend of solar cell efficiency in previous years we come to know that in the past 5 years, the percentage has increased from 15%- 20%. But one thing should be kept in mind: different types of solar panels have their own criteria for efficiency. Therefore, before purchasing solar panels this thing should greatly be considered.

Kinds of solar cells
There are many types of solar cells but the most widely used solar cells are of three types. These are the following.
- Monocrystalline
A single-cell crystal that is made up of silicon
- Polycrystalline
Multi cells crystal comprised of silicon
- Thin-filmed
Thin sheets that are created by substances like amorphous silicon, gallium, copper, and cadmium.
The table below shows us the rate of efficiency as well as the price ranges of solar cells.
Solar cell type | Rate of efficiency | Overall cost |
---|---|---|
Monocrystalline | 20% | Expensive |
Polycrystalline | 15% | Moderate |
Thin-Filmed | 10% | Affordable |
How to make your solar cells work efficiently?
Different types of solar panels have their own mode of working. Due to the different types, it is certain that solar panels cannot provide similar output and efficiency. But there are three methods that can help to improve both of these factors. These techniques are utilizing Solar concentrators, making use of Solar mirrors, and optimization by the angle of panels. Now, let us have a discussion about these processes.
Solar concentrators
- Works by lens called “Fresnel Lens”. It is used to concentrate light onto the solar cell
- The solar cells for such concentrators are crafted on the basis of the concentration level of the lens
- Use of this methodology increases the efficiency up to 40%
Solar mirrors
- This technology is under the framework of research for the future
- Researchers in America and India have strived to add mirrors adjacent to solar panels
- For regions where there is excessive heat then this technology is not effective but in colder regions, it will be a blessing
- According to IEEE’s Journal of Photovoltaics this technology has found to be useful in solar farms
- With this technology we can obtain to about 30% of energy production
Optimization of the panel’s angle
- Generally the solar panel should face the sun perpendicular and follows an accurate angle
- It also depends upon regional preferences. For instance, if you are in the Northern region then the angle should be the south and vice versa for a Southern region
- There are many strategies to estimate the angle but the most proficient is using the tilt angle technique. For this, the +150 latitude of the location is set for winter, and for summer it is -150.
- To achieve better efficiency tilt angles can be changed four times a year
- But if you keep a better analysis regarding the sun’s movement then you can gain better output with energy
What are the tips to increase solar panel efficiency?
Avoiding Shade
The working mechanism of solar panels involves sunlight. Without it, they cannot generate useful energy. To maintain better performance these should be prevented from the shade. Shade harms the output, so to avoid issues with energy production these panels must be installed in areas where there is no impact of shade.
Facing Sun
Solar panels need natural light as a necessary element. It can never work without getting proper sunlight. To achieve higher outputs of energy these should be set up right towards the angle facing the sun.
Cleaning
Equipment of panels is stationary and not moving. It does not need high maintenance. But, it does require proper cleaning once in a while. This step is essential as it can disrupt the output. Therefore, to get valuable energy output this credential should be followed.
